The Kimberley has a tropical climate characterised by two very distinct seasons. In the Dry Season, from late April til September, the region experiences clear blue skies, predominantly light winds and balmy days with some cooler mornings and nights. Temperatures during the dry season vary between 26 and 36 degrees in March and April, 14 and 30 degrees from June to August and 19 to 32 degrees during September. The Wet Season spans from October til April and the region sees increase humidity and rainfall during this time.
